Women and The Workforce in Libya

In Libya, the majority of college graduates are women – 77% compared to 63% for men. However after graduation, only 43% of women enter the workforce. Al Jazeera takes a look at special interest groups … [Read more...]

‘Womenomics’ Transforming Middle-East

In Qatar, Bahrain, Kuwait, Algeria, Oman, Jordan, Lebanon and Saudi Arabia, university enrollment rates for women are exceeding those for men. Saadia Zahidi, from the World Economic Forum, reports … [Read more...]
